What’s New in TFS 2012?- Introduction


In this series I will start introducing what’s new in Visual Studio 11 and Team Foundation Server 11 ( TFS 11) or as we expect to be Visual Studio 2012 and Team Foundation Server 2012 (TFS 2012)

 

  1. Introduction
  2. Project Management Tool
  3. SSDT (SQL Server Developer Tool)
  4. Team Explorer
  5. My Work
  6. Code Review
  7. Suspend and Resume
  8. Local Workspace
  9. Pending Change
  10. Diff and Merge tool
  11. Unit Testing Improvement
  12. Code Clones
  13. Build Improvement
  14. Storyboarding
  15. Microsoft Feedback Client
  16. Exploratory Testing Improvement
  17. IntelliTrace in Production
  18. Alerts
  19. Administration

 

——————————————————————————————————————————————-

Introduction

I perform the Team Foundation Server (TFS) 11 Beta upgrade from the day one of the Beta release, I read many blog articles, MSDN, I also saw many videos, so I will not re-invent the wheel by rewriting what I have read or view through out all the previous period, but I will put the main point of the new features or improvement and I will put my feedback and realization about these features.

So the first question why we upgrade specially that the RTM not released yet?

This always one of my main question all the time for any new technologies or framework, unfortunately my answer was far from what I believe now, I used to trust of my experience and my existing solution, but what I found? I found that all my solutions are out dated and there are elegant solutions there, perfect, fast, easy and I just missed all of them all the time, eventually I realize the truth! the world keeping change and there are always improvement and your perfect solution today will be the worst tomorrow :-(

The new technologies means new features and enhance for the old, some people said and new bugs too! especially in the beta, absolutely right, but ……

It’s always what you get more and more bigger than what you face of issues or bugs and you know that if you really master your tools, it’s a long story to tell so enough talk and let’s see what I decide.

So this what I believed now!

This why the upgrade is a must for me and I always waiting for it and guess what? it has more than I expected :-)

Getting Religion with TFS for Agile Software Development!



In this 5 minutes video, I introduced TFSEG Values and Principles, I believe these principles will help many people and it may change their life if they are believers, it will also put the roadmap for our contributors that want to join the user group and tell them what we believe, to summarize the video, it will show the value of automation, teamwork, code guidance, rules, unit testing, etc and how all these fit with Agile and TFS Team Foundation Server.

Each principle may need a whole day from me to represent but the presentation only about 5 minutes, because it just introduce these principles, so if anyone has a question or inquiry please don’t hesitate to contact me, I may create a details video later based on the community demand and questions.

Waiting for your feedback and questions

For the prize of the video just see this post

Visual Studio 11 Beta Wallpapers and Windows Theme v 2.0



***Update Jun 23, 2012*****
The new Wallpapers and Theme for Visual Studio 2012 here

———————————————————————————————–

After the successes of my first post which is ” Visual Studio 11 Beta Wallpapers and Windows Theme“, I decided to create a new post with new wallpapers and themes of Visual Studio but this time I made some new modification, the first themes in this post will include our TFSEG Values and Principles, see the video, the second one will not has these Principles and finally there are some separate wallpapers.

Here, you can find the first theme with TFSEG Values and Principles.

For some old wallpapers click here

Download the theme with the principles

Download the theme without the principles

Here, you can find  separate wallpapers

Visual Studio 11 ALM Hands-On-Labs in Arabic


Update   July 27, 2012

These labs become obsolete and there are new labs on the following link

هذه المعامل عفا عليها الزمن، وهناك معامل جديدة على الرابطه التاليه

Visual Studio 2012 RC ALM Hands-On-Labs Now in Arabic

End of update

لقد انتهيت من اعداد التجارب المعملية للفيجول استوديو 11 التجريبى باللغة العربية، هذه التجارب المعملية سوف تعرض الامكانيات الجديدة للفيجول استوديو وتيم فونديشن سيرفر 11 التجريبى، كما سوف نقوم فى تى اف اس ايجبت جروب بتقديم هذه التجارب على هيئة فيديو باللغة العربية ايضا وسوف نقدم الدعم الفنى لأى مشكله قد تواجة البعض عند اجراء هذه التجارب، فقط اطلب المساعدة، فنحن فى انتظار انضمامكم لنا كمستمعيين او منظميين او مشاركيين، فنحن نريد ان نوسع ونزيد من قدرتنا على استخدام تيم فونديشن سيرفر 11 والتى سوف تنعكس على جودة المشاريع التى نقدمها

للحصول على النسخة الانجليزية قم بزيارة موقع براين كيلر

لاحظ انه لابد من تواجد الجهاز الافتراضى الموجود على موقع براين كيلر حتى تتمكن من اجراء هذه التجارب المعملية

لتحميل اى اختبار معملى، فقط اضغط على الرابطة

اختبار الوحدة برنامج اختبار مايكروسوفت, ووحدة إن,وشبكة وحدية إكس., ونسخ الكود مع فيجوال أستوديو 11

إدارة أيجيل للمشاريع في برنامج تيم فاونديشن سيرفر11

الاختبار الاستكشافي والتحسينات الأخرى في برنامج مايكروسوفت تست مانجر 11

بناء البرامج الصحيحة إنشاء اللوحة التوضيحية وتجميع التغذية الرجعية للمستفيدين في برنامج فيجوال أستوديو 11

تشخيص المشاكل في الإنتاج مع إنتيليتريس و فيجوال أستوديو 11

جعل المطورين أكثر إنتاجية مع تيم فاونديشن سيرفر 11

I completed the translation of Visual Studio 11 Hands-On-Labs in Arabic, these labs will introduce the new features of the Visual Studio and TFS 11 Beta, these labs also will be provided in webcast and video in Arabic very soon through our TFS Egypt User Group (TFSEG), we also will provide an online support for these labs so if you find any problem to perform any lab,  just ask for help, we are waiting for more people to join our TFS Egypt User Group (TFSEG), join as listener, helper, coordinator or contributor, we really want to spread and grow up our usage of  TFS that will provide a real software quality to our projects.

For the original English version you can visit Brian Keller blog here

Both English and Arabic Labs will need the new VM of the Brain Keller that has the new bits of the Visual Studio and TFS 11 Beta

To download any lab in Arabic just click on the lab link

Unit Testing with Visual Studio 11 – MSTest, NUnit, xUnit.net, and Code Clone

Agile Project Management in Team Foundation Server 11

Exploratory Testing and Other Enhancements in Microsoft Test Manager 11

Building the Right Software – Generating Storyboards and Collecting Stakeholder Feedback with Visual Studio 11

Diagnosing Issues in Production with IntelliTrace and Visual Studio 11

Making Developers More Productive with Team Foundation Server 11

TFS Egypt User Group (TFSEG) Kick off meeting and Roadmap April 18, 2012


Note: Please note that all sessions, webcasts and videos of TFSEG are localized and  introduced in Arabic only

 

The first kick off meeting of TFS Egypt User Group (TFSEG) is being held on April 18, 2012 at 7:00 PM in Ocean Soft premises, 70 El-Thawra St, Cairo Egypt

https://sites.google.com/site/tfsegyptusergroup/calendar/kickoffmeetingandroadmapapril182012

The User Group is for all software job roles even the customer within the software industry. So if you are involved in product management, a stakeholder, a business analysis or product owner, a developer or a tester this User Group is for you.

We will discuss the roadmap and our technologies, our mission and aims.

Waiting for you :-)

TFSEG
For more information see our calendar here

https://sites.google.com/site/tfsegyptusergroup/calendar/kickoffmeetingandroadmapapril182012

To download Visual Studio and TFS 11 Beta click on the following link
http://www.microsoft.com/visualstudio/11/en-us/downloads

Lab 5:Introduction to Test Case Management with Microsoft Test Manager 11 Beta



TFS 11 Beta Hands-on Lab series–

Lab 5:Introduction to Test Case Management with Microsoft Test Manager 11 Beta

In this series the following labs:

  1. Introduction
  2. Lab 1: Authoring and Running Manual Tests using Microsoft Test Manager 11 Beta
  3. Lab2: Introduction to Coded UI Tests with Visual Studio 11 Beta
  4. Lab 3: Introduction to Test Planning with Microsoft Test Manager 11 Beta
  5. Lab 4: Authoring and Running Shared Steps within Test Case Using Microsoft Test Manager 11 Beta
  6. Lab 5:Introduction to Test Case Management with Microsoft Test Manager 11 Beta
——————————————————————————————————————————————-

6. Lab 5:Introduction to Test Case Management with Microsoft Test Manager 11 Beta

This lab will show you,

How to manage test settings? How to manage test configurations? What are the test suites type exist in MTM? How to create test plan? How to run plan?  How to Analyze test runs? How to track changes using Test Impact Analysis?

 

To download Visual Studio and TFS 11 Beta click on the following link
http://www.microsoft.com/visualstudio/11/en-us/downloads

Lab 4: Authoring and Running Shared Steps within Test Case Using Microsoft Test Manager 11 Beta



TFS 11 Beta Hands-on Lab series–

Lab 4: Authoring and Running Shared Steps within Test Case Using Microsoft Test Manager 11 Beta

In this series the following labs:

  1. Introduction
  2. Lab 1: Authoring and Running Manual Tests using Microsoft Test Manager 11 Beta
  3. Lab2: Introduction to Coded UI Tests with Visual Studio 11 Beta
  4. Lab 3: Introduction to Test Planning with Microsoft Test Manager 11 Beta
  5. Lab 4: Authoring and Running Shared Steps within Test Case Using Microsoft Test Manager 11 Beta
  6. Lab 5:Introduction to Test Case Management with Microsoft Test Manager 11 Beta
——————————————————————————————————————————————-

5. Lab 4: Authoring and Running Shared Steps within Test Case Using Microsoft Test Manager 11 Beta

This lab will show you, how to create Shared Steps? How to record action separately for Shared Steps? How to include Shared Steps in Test Cases? This video also will show you, how to record Shared Steps during the record of the parent Test Case? And finally how to run fast forward for all recorded Shared Steps?

You can download the test script of the lab from here

 

To download Visual Studio and TFS 11 Beta click on the following link
http://www.microsoft.com/visualstudio/11/en-us/downloads

Lab 3: Introduction to Test Planning with Microsoft Test Manager 11 Beta



TFS 11 Beta Hands-on Lab series–

Lab 3: Introduction to Test Planning with Microsoft Test Manager 11 Beta

In this series the following labs:

  1. Introduction
  2. Lab 1: Authoring and Running Manual Tests using Microsoft Test Manager 11 Beta
  3. Lab2: Introduction to Coded UI Tests with Visual Studio 11 Beta
  4. Lab 3: Introduction to Test Planning with Microsoft Test Manager 11 Beta
  5. Lab 4: Authoring and Running Shared Steps within Test Case Using Microsoft Test Manager 11 Beta
  6. Lab 5:Introduction to Test Case Management with Microsoft Test Manager 11 Beta
——————————————————————————————————————————————-

3. Lab 3: Introduction to Test Planning with Microsoft Test Manager 11 Beta

This lab will show you, how to create configuring a Test Plan in Microsoft Test Manager 11 Beta,  How to add Test Suites and Test Cases to a Test Plan.

 

To download Visual Studio and TFS 11 Beta click on the following link
http://www.microsoft.com/visualstudio/11/en-us/downloads

Lab 2: Introduction to Coded UI Tests with Visual Studio 11 Beta



TFS 11 Beta Hands-on Lab series–

Lab 2: Introduction to Coded UI Tests with Visual Studio 11 Beta

In this series the following labs:

  1. Introduction
  2. Lab 1: Authoring and Running Manual Tests using Microsoft Test Manager 11 Beta
  3. Lab2: Introduction to Coded UI Tests with Visual Studio 11 Beta
  4. Lab 3: Introduction to Test Planning with Microsoft Test Manager 11 Beta
  5. Lab 4: Authoring and Running Shared Steps within Test Case Using Microsoft Test Manager 11 Beta
  6. Lab 5:Introduction to Test Case Management with Microsoft Test Manager 11 Beta
——————————————————————————————————————————————-

2. Lab 2: Introduction to Coded UI Tests with Visual Studio 11 Beta

This lab will show you, how to create Coded UI from action recording? How create Coded UI from Coded UI Test Builder? How to create and run Data Driven Coded UI test?

 

To download Visual Studio and TFS 11 Beta click on the following link
http://www.microsoft.com/visualstudio/11/en-us/downloads

Lab 1: Authoring and Running Manual Tests using Microsoft Test Manager 11 Beta



TFS 11 Beta Hands-on Lab series–

Lab 1: Authoring and Running Manual Tests using Microsoft Test Manager 11 Beta

In this series the following labs:

  1. Introduction
  2. Lab 1: Authoring and Running Manual Tests using Microsoft Test Manager 11 Beta
  3. Lab2: Introduction to Coded UI Tests with Visual Studio 11 Beta
  4. Lab 3: Introduction to Test Planning with Microsoft Test Manager 11 Beta
  5. Lab 4: Authoring and Running Shared Steps within Test Case Using Microsoft Test Manager 11 Beta
  6. Lab 5:Introduction to Test Case Management with Microsoft Test Manager 11 Beta
——————————————————————————————————————————————-

2. Lab 1: Authoring and Running Manual Tests using Microsoft Test Manager 11 Beta

This lab will show you, how to create test case? How to run test case? How to investigate test result? How to create shared steps.

 

To download Visual Studio and TFS 11 Beta click on the following link
http://www.microsoft.com/visualstudio/11/en-us/downloads